Usually what the person does (and the quality of their work) is closely related to their sense of self-worth, so they need to "do" things in order to feel good about themselves. I think that's how it plays out. Feeling competent and useful is also very important.IP: Logged |

I have a 6th house sun and ive heard that people with this placement feel the most happy in life when they have a routine, that they tend to feel lost in life without one.I have also read that the person and their life is revolved around the attainment of perfection in some area, for example mohammad ali and michael jackson, they were perfectionists/meticulous with their craft which lead to their success. I saw on a youtube something like these people are born with some sort of imperfection of one sort or the other, and that they spend much of their lives attempting to fix it, and thus become something of a master in that area. IE someone who was a chubby kid in youth that ends up becoming meticulous with his diet, health and workout and develops a perfect body as a result. Personally I find that the association with the drive for perfection in life is true for me. It can seem daunting though as if I feel I am never good enough or have an endless number of perceived flaws or problems to work on, but it is this feeling that drives me to work harder and become a better person as a result.
